Q. From the lumen to the external surface what are the tissues that form the digestive tube wall?
From the internal surface to the external surface, the digestive tube wall is made of submucosa (connective tissue beneath the mucous membrane and where blood and lymphatic vessels and neural fibers are located), mucosa (epithelial tissue responsible for the intestinal absorption), muscle layers (smooth muscle tissue, two layers, one interior circular and other exterior longitudinal, structures responsible for the peristaltic movement), serous membrane (associated epithelial and connective tissue forming the external surface of the organ). In the bowels the serous membrane prolongs to form the mesentery a serosa that encloses blood vessels and supports the bowels within the abdominal cavity.
